As of April 2026, downloading and installing (CTR Importable Archive) files remains the standard method for adding software to a modded Nintendo 3DS. While the official eShop has been closed for purchases since March 2023, the homebrew community continues to provide updated tools for managing, downloading, and installing game backups, updates, and DLC. A file is the standard format used by Nintendo to distribute software updates, downloadable content (DLC), and digital games through the official Nintendo eShop.

Downloading CIA files of games you do not own is generally classified as piracy and is illegal in most regions. The community strongly encourages only downloading files for games and software you have legally purchased.
